Ingredients for Easy Taco Soup

  • 1 lb lean ground beef
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, finely diced
  • ½ red bell pepper, diced
  • ½ green bell pepper, diced
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 2 tablespoons taco seasoning (store-bought or homemade)
  • 1 can (16 oz) beans (kidney, pinto, or black beans), drained
  • 1 cup corn (fresh, canned, or frozen)
  • 1 ½ cups diced tomatoes (fresh or canned)
  • 2 cups beef broth (or chicken/vegetable broth)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Cook the Meat and Vegetables

Heat ol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the ground beef, diced onion, and bell peppers. Cook until the beef is browned and the vegetables are soft, about 7-10 minutes. Drain any excess fat.

2. Add Garlic and Taco Seasoning

Stir in the minced garlic and taco seasoning. Cook for another minute until fragrant.

3. Combine Remaining Ingredients

Add the beans, corn, diced tomatoes, and beef broth to the pot. Stir well to combine.

4. Simmer the Soup

Bring the soup to a boil, then reduce heat to low. Cover and let it simmer for 15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ld. Taste and adjust seasoning with salt, pepper, or extra taco seasoning if needed.

5. Serve and Garnish

Ladle the soup into bowls and top with your favorite garnishes like shredded cheese, sour cream, avocado slices, cilantro, green onions, or crushed tortilla chips.

Tips for the Best Taco Soup

  • Make it vegetarian: Skip the meat and add extra beans or use a plant-based ground meat substitute.
  • Use homemade taco seasoning: Mix chili powder, cumin,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, oregano, salt, and pepper for a fresh, flavorful blend.
  • Freeze leftovers: This soup freezes well. Cool completely, then store in airtight containers for up to 3 months.
  • Adjust thickness: For a thicker soup, reduce broth or simmer uncovered longer. For thinner soup, add more broth or water.
  • Add heat: Include diced jalapeños or a splash of hot sauce for a spicy kick.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Can I make taco soup without ground beef?

Yes! You can substitute ground turkey, chicken, or even use no meat at all by adding extra beans or a plant-based meat alternative. The soup will still be delicious and hearty.

2. How long does taco soup last in the fridge?

Taco soup can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at on the stove or in the microwave before serving.

3. Can I freeze taco soup?

Absolutely. Let the soup cool completely, then freeze in airtight containers or freezer bags for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ge and reheat gently.

4. What toppings go best with taco soup?

Popular toppings include shredded cheddar or Monterey Jack cheese, sour cream or Greek yogurt, diced avocado, fresh cilantro, green onions, crushed tortilla chips, and lime wedges.

5. Is taco soup spicy?

The spice level depends on the taco seasoning you use. You can control the heat by choosing mild or spicy seasoning blends and adding jalapeños or hot sauce to taste.

Ingredients
  

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 small onion chopped
  • 1 packet taco seasoning
  • 1 can 15 oz black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 can 15 oz kidney be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 can 15 oz corn, undrained
  • 1 can 15 oz diced tomatoes with green chilies
  • 1 can 8 oz tomato sauce
  • cups beef broth
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ional toppings: shredded cheese sour cream, avocado, tortilla chips

Instructions
 

  • Brown ground beef with chopped onion in a large pot over medium heat.
  • Drain excess fat, then stir in taco seasoning.
  • Add beans, corn, diced tomatoes, tomato sauce, and beef broth.
  • Stir everything together and bring to a boil.
  • Reduce heat and simmer uncovered for 15–20 minutes.
  • Season with salt and pepper if needed.
  • Ladle into bowls and top with your favorite taco toppings.

Notes

Swap ground beef with ground turkey or chicken for a lighter version.
Make it spicy by adding jalapeños or extra chili powder.
Freezes well for up to 3 months—great for meal prep.
